We know that most of you are beginning to plan your travel and arrival, so we have created a survey to help us capture your plans and provide more detailed information about the move-in process. The general guidelines that we will use to organize this process are outlined below. As always, we are happy to take questions.
 
We ask that you complete the Arrival Survey, by following the link listed at the bottom of this email, by Monday, July 20 at 5:00 p.m. ET. As you complete the survey, please be advised that:

  1. All students will be asked to take a COVID-19 test once they arrive on campus. You will be asked to sign up for a time to go to Dartmouth College Health Services to take this test. The testing process should take about 15 minutes.
     
  2. All students need to complete the survey, regardless of where you will be living. We have separate questions for on and off campus students.
     
  3. If you are an international student, you will be asked to provide information, to the best of your ability, about your visa appointment. We are very mindful that a large part of the visa process is out of your individual control.
     
  4. Students living off campus will still be required to come to campus to register, pick-up mailbox and locker keys, and receive their student ID.
     
  5. Students living on campus will be asked to sign up for a two-hour time slot to move into their dorm room. We can only accommodate a certain number of people in each time block, due to social distancing requirements.
     
  6. The booking tool will be filled on a first-come, first-served basis until the slots in a particular time block are all reserved. When all time slots are reserved, that block will no longer be listed.
